Output d3a80991a3b63bf6f3678e55bc72f529fdb2e0bb9ffd633891f04f9b1c6414c7:0

value
1251074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37bd806e8e960605251ba7d3cb823eca28d200ea OP_EQUAL
address
36mk6uJ9nFzVCe7VK3XH1BYt5oTUeDEjFw
transaction
d3a80991a3b63bf6f3678e55bc72f529fdb2e0bb9ffd633891f04f9b1c6414c7
confirmations
405673
spent
true